Officials arrest 42 traffic offenders, take them to mobile court

Yesterday, 42 traffic offenders were taken to a mobile court in Osun by FRSC officials.

On Wednesday, October 21st, officials of Federal Road Safety Corps (FRSC) arrested 42 traffic offenders.

Charges included the use of fake drivers licenses, driving against traffic, over speeding and more.

The offender were tried at a Mobile Court at Ogoluwa area along Gbongan Road Osogbo, Osun State.

Last week, Thursday, October 15th, the governor of Ekiti State, Ayo Fayose, also arrested a traffic offender, Adeola Alabi.

While FRSC officials took their offenders to a court, Fayose ordered that the offender's vehicle be taken to the office of the Ekiti State Traffic Management Agency in Ado Ekiti.

Also, he asked the offender to pay all necessary fines.
